Future Value
The value of an investment or cash flow at a specific future date, adjusted for time value of money and interest.
Discount Rate
The interest rate used to discount future cash flows to their present value, often reflecting the cost of capital or the risk of the investment.
Present Value
The present evaluation of a future cash sum or series of cash receipts, factoring in a certain rate of return for discounting.
